Keycloak: Unauthorized access via improper validation of encrypted SAML assertions
Keycloak's SAML broker endpoint does not properly validate encrypted assertions when the overall SAML response is not signed. An attacker with a valid signed SAML assertion can exploit this by crafting a malicious SAML response, injecting an encrypted assertion for an arbitrary principal, leading to unauthorized access and potential information disclosure.
